However, the disadvantages of these electrochemical energy storage systems include the following: life time reduction at temperatures below 0°C (at − 20°C for lithium-ion batteries, the number of charge–discharge cycles can be reduced by 50%). Lead-acid batteries are used as short- and medium-term energy storage systems.

Energy Density: Thermal storage systems generally possess lower energy density compared to electrochemical and mechanical systems. This limitation means they require more space or a larger physical footprint to store the same amount of energy, which can be a significant drawback in space-constrained environments.
